Activate Ransomware Protection with Immutable Backups
Ransomware attacks now occur every 11 seconds, making immutable backups a non-negotiable part of any security strategy. Our storage includes S3 Object Lock, which makes your Veeam backups unchangeable for a defined period. This Write-Once-Read-Many (WORM) model prevents malicious encryption or deletion by any user or process. Object Lock is your last line of defense, ensuring a clean copy of your data is always available for recovery. Following the 3-2-1-1-0 backup rule requires an immutable copy. This feature is critical for creating audit-ready retention policies and strengthening your overall resilience posture.

Achieve Regulatory Readiness for EU Data Act and NIS-2
Upcoming EU regulations demand a new level of data governance and security. Our platform is designed to help you meet these future requirements today. The EU Data Act, applicable from September 2025, mandates data portability to prevent vendor lock-in, a principle core to our open-standards approach. The NIS-2 Directive requires continuous security processes, including supply-chain assurance and strict incident reporting timelines. Our operations, built around multi-layer encryption and robust IAM controls, are aligned with these principles. Implement a Practical and Resilient Veeam Storage Strategy
Transitioning to a sovereign cloud vault for your Veeam backups is a straightforward process. The full S3 compatibility ensures a simple configuration change is all that is needed. Here is a practical checklist to guide your migration:
- Confirm your Veeam licensing supports cloud capacity tiers.
- Create a new S3-compatible object storage repository in your Veeam console.
- Configure the repository with your Impossible Cloud endpoint, access keys, and a geofenced German bucket.
- Enable Object Lock in the repository settings to create immutable backups.
- Update your backup copy jobs to target the new sovereign repository.
- Perform a test restore to validate the configuration and performance.
